CustomTypeDescriptor Конструкторы
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Инициализирует новый экземпляр класса CustomTypeDescriptor.
Перегрузки
CustomTypeDescriptor() |
Инициализирует новый экземпляр класса CustomTypeDescriptor. |
CustomTypeDescriptor(ICustomTypeDescriptor) |
Инициализирует новый экземпляр класса CustomTypeDescriptor, используя дескриптор родительского настраиваемого типа. |
CustomTypeDescriptor()
- Исходный код:
- CustomTypeDescriptor.cs
- Исходный код:
- CustomTypeDescriptor.cs
- Исходный код:
- CustomTypeDescriptor.cs
Инициализирует новый экземпляр класса CustomTypeDescriptor.
protected:
CustomTypeDescriptor();
protected CustomTypeDescriptor ();
Protected Sub New ()
Комментарии
Этот конструктор эквивалентен вызову другого CustomTypeDescriptor.CustomTypeDescriptor конструктора с параметром , равным null
.
Все методы, созданные CustomTypeDescriptor с помощью этого конструктора, будут возвращать значения по умолчанию.
См. также раздел
Применяется к
CustomTypeDescriptor(ICustomTypeDescriptor)
- Исходный код:
- CustomTypeDescriptor.cs
- Исходный код:
- CustomTypeDescriptor.cs
- Исходный код:
- CustomTypeDescriptor.cs
Инициализирует новый экземпляр класса CustomTypeDescriptor, используя дескриптор родительского настраиваемого типа.
protected:
CustomTypeDescriptor(System::ComponentModel::ICustomTypeDescriptor ^ parent);
protected CustomTypeDescriptor (System.ComponentModel.ICustomTypeDescriptor parent);
protected CustomTypeDescriptor (System.ComponentModel.ICustomTypeDescriptor? parent);
new System.ComponentModel.CustomTypeDescriptor : System.ComponentModel.ICustomTypeDescriptor -> System.ComponentModel.CustomTypeDescriptor
Protected Sub New (parent As ICustomTypeDescriptor)
Параметры
- parent
- ICustomTypeDescriptor
Дескриптор родительского настраиваемого типа.
Комментарии
parent
Если параметр имеет значение null
, все CustomTypeDescriptor методы будут возвращать значения по умолчанию. В противном случае все CustomTypeDescriptor методы будут делегировать методы parent
.
Большинство CustomTypeDescriptor методов возвращаются null
по умолчанию. В следующей таблице показаны возвращаемые значения для методов, которые не возвращаются null
по умолчанию.
Метод | Возвращаемое значение по умолчанию |
---|---|
GetAttributes | Пустая коллекция атрибутов (AttributeCollection.Empty). |
GetConverter | Экземпляр по умолчанию TypeConverter . |
GetEvents | Пустая коллекция событий (EventDescriptorCollection.Empty). |
GetProperties | Пустая коллекция свойств (PropertyDescriptorCollection.Empty). |
См. также раздел
Применяется к
Обратная связь
https://aka.ms/ContentUserFeedback.
Ожидается в ближайшее время: в течение 2024 года мы постепенно откажемся от GitHub Issues как механизма обратной связи для контента и заменим его новой системой обратной связи. Дополнительные сведения см. в разделеОтправить и просмотреть отзыв по